WebEffacement is described as a percentage. For example, if your cervix is not effaced at all, it is 0% effaced. If the cervix has completely thinned, it is 100% effaced. Dilatation. After the cervix begins to efface, it will also start to open. This is called cervical dilatation. Cervical dilatation is described in centimeters from 0 to 10.

WebIn figures A and B, the cervix is tightly closed. In figure C, the cervix is 60% effaced and 1 to 2 cm dilated. In figure D, the cervix is 90% effaced and 4 to 5 cm dilated. The cervix must be 100% effaced and 10 cm dilated before a vaginal delivery. WebJul 24, 2024 · 3 min read.
